태그 보관물: 브라우저 프론트엔드

브라우저 프론트엔드에서 OpenTelemetry 번들 크기 줄이기

대표 이미지

브라우저 프론트엔드에서 OpenTelemetry 번들 크기 줄이기

OpenTelemetry는 분산 시스템의 모니터링과 추적을 위한 오픈소스 프로젝트입니다. 브라우저 프론트엔드에서 OpenTelemetry를 사용하면 애플리케이션의 성능과 사용자 경험을 개선할 수 있지만, 번들 크기가 증가할 수 있습니다. 이 글에서는 브라우저 프론트엔드에서 OpenTelemetry 번들 크기를 줄이는 방법에 대해 알아봅니다.

3줄 요약

  • OpenTelemetry는 분산 시스템의 모니터링과 추적을 위한 오픈소스 프로젝트입니다.
  • 브라우저 프론트엔드에서 OpenTelemetry를 사용하면 애플리케이션의 성능과 사용자 경험을 개선할 수 있지만, 번들 크기가 증가할 수 있습니다.
  • 번들 크기를 줄이기 위해 코드 분할, 트리 쉐이킹, 압축 등을 사용할 수 있습니다.

핵심: OpenTelemetry 번들 크기를 줄이기 위해 코드 분할, 트리 쉐이킹, 압축 등을 사용할 수 있습니다.

코드 분할

코드 분할은 브라우저 프론트엔드에서 OpenTelemetry 번들 크기를 줄이는 데 사용할 수 있는 기술입니다. 코드 분할을 사용하면 OpenTelemetry 코드를 여러 개의 작은 파일로 분할하여, 필요한 파일만 로드할 수 있습니다.

기능 코드 분할 트리 쉐이킹 압축
번들 크기 감소 감소 감소
성능 개선 개선 개선

요약: 코드 분할, 트리 쉐이킹, 압축 등을 사용하면 OpenTelemetry 번들 크기를 줄일 수 있습니다.

트리 쉐이킹

트리 쉐이킹은 브라우저 프론트엔드에서 OpenTelemetry 번들 크기를 줄이는 데 사용할 수 있는 기술입니다. 트리 쉐이킹을 사용하면 OpenTelemetry 코드에서 사용되지 않는 부분을 제거하여, 번들 크기를 줄일 수 있습니다.

압축

압축은 브라우저 프론트엔드에서 OpenTelemetry 번들 크기를 줄이는 데 사용할 수 있는 기술입니다. 압축을 사용하면 OpenTelemetry 코드를 압축하여, 번들 크기를 줄일 수 있습니다.

실무 적용

실무에서 OpenTelemetry 번들 크기를 줄이기 위해 코드 분할, 트리 쉐이킹, 압축 등을 사용할 수 있습니다. 또한, OpenTelemetry를 사용하는 애플리케이션의 성능과 사용자 경험을 개선하기 위해, 성능, 로그, 비용 등을 고려해야 합니다.

FAQ

Q: OpenTelemetry 번들 크기를 줄이는 방법은 무엇인가?

A: 코드 분할, 트리 쉐이킹, 압축 등을 사용할 수 있습니다.

Q: 코드 분할의 장점은 무엇인가?

A: 코드 분할을 사용하면 OpenTelemetry 코드를 여러 개의 작은 파일로 분할하여, 필요한 파일만 로드할 수 있습니다.

Q: 트리 쉐이킹의 장점은 무엇인가?

A: 트리 쉐이킹을 사용하면 OpenTelemetry 코드에서 사용되지 않는 부분을 제거하여, 번들 크기를 줄일 수 있습니다.

Q: 압축의 장점은 무엇인가?

A: 압축을 사용하면 OpenTelemetry 코드를 압축하여, 번들 크기를 줄일 수 있습니다.

Q: OpenTelemetry를 사용하는 애플리케이션의 성능과 사용자 경험을 개선하기 위해 고려해야 할 사항은 무엇인가?

A: 성능, 로그, 비용 등을 고려해야 합니다.

관련 글 추천

OpenTelemetry를 사용한 애플리케이션 모니터링

OpenTelemetry를 사용한 사용자 경험 개선

보조 이미지 1

보조 이미지 2